Europe is a big place but quite manageable and convenient when cruising from port to port. But first you must get there from North America. That involves either a Transatlantic Voyage or a plane trip to your European port of disembarkation. Once there, the choices are many.
Northern Europe includes Scandinavia, Russia, Greenland, Iceland and Eastern Europe. Europe is Great Britain, Ireland, France, Holland, and the low countries. Then there is the Western and Eastern Mediterranean, the Holy Land, and Egypt. River cruises on famous rivers such as the Rhine, Mein, Danube, Volga, and Seine give you an exceptional view of the interior of Europe.
